There is some sort of VOIP Option 150 and I've been asked if DHCP on Microsoft Server 2003 supports option 150 and I cannot find anything that says yes or no. Any information related to this would be greatly appreciated.
 
Check with the HW Vendor. MS DHCP allow you to specify/create/configure Vendor Classes. I have done this with the Cisco Airespace AP's. So out of the box it didn't have an option, but I was able to create the option following Cisco's instuctions.
 
Yes Microsoft 2003 Server supports DHCP option 150. This specific option is used by Cisco phones to record the IP Address of the TFTP servers (Read Call manager). When the phone boots it uses the IP Addresses listed in option 150 to request its phone load.
